Some Things That Make You Have to Stop Criticizing Ronaldo

Cristiano Ronaldo has always been a concern of many parties. The movement of the star on the green field could never escape the media target. This player who successfully donated 4 Champions League awards to Real Madrid decided to continue his career in the Italian Serie A by defending Juventus. However, the beginning of the CR7’s career in the Italian League was considered not too smooth as he has difficulties in adapting and some even considered that Ronaldo would not succeed with the Old Lady.

As it is known that Ronaldo is a steel-minded player. Any sharp criticism and insults will be ignored by this Portuguese star’s mind. It was too early to consider how Ronaldo’s career in Serie A would be as he has just set foot in the Pizza Country. Ronaldo is a great player. Sooner or later he will soon prove his quality as the world’s best player. So, here we will present some things that make you have to stop criticizing Cristiano Ronaldo…

Ronaldo came to Turin not without supplies. He bagged a lot of achievements that he brought when defending the previous team. The statistics also mentioned that since 2010 Ronaldo had always scored more than 50 goals for his team. This achievement was not impossible to be achieved with Juventus. This certainly proves that Ronaldo is not a careless player. He is the best Juventus player at the moment. The hard work of the player whose nickname is ‘CR7’ also paid as he managed to put an impression in Maximiliano Allegri of Juventus allenatore.

According to Allegri, Ronaldo is a very extraordinary player. He was able to give a huge impact on Juventus. Ronaldo’s arrival was considered to be able to make Juventus getting more powerful on all fronts.

“The arrival of Ronaldo further catapulted Juventus,”

“Juventus has just arrived at the world’s best player. Players who have competed with Messi in the past 11 years to get the Ballon d’Or,”

“And he is the top scorer of all the UEFA Champions League”

The next thing that makes Ronaldo does not deserve many critics is that he will always shine wherever he goes. When he managed to help the red devil in winning a number of prestigious awards, it was even said that no one had been able to replace his position at Manchester United. When he moved to Real Madrid, his career was shining, unlike Messi who only worked with Barcelona, Ronaldo was able to prove his prowess in Spain and even able to dominate the Blue Continent up to 4 times with el Real. In this case, Ronaldo commented,

“I don’t need to prove anything to people,”

“You already know my achievements and I’m a very ambitious person,”

“I will continue to look for challenges and I don’t like it when I’m always in the comfort zone,”

“Therefore, I will make history with Juventus as good as when I played for Manchester United and Real Madrid.”

Besides his flashy achievements, Ronaldo’s arrival also made his colleagues amazed. Many Juventus players feel fortunate to be able to play with Ronaldo and some even think that they have never met a player like Ronaldo before. Like Alex Sandro’s confession,

“Ronaldo is a truly talented player. Wherever he plays, his colleagues will always learn a lot from him,”

“Even though it was only some weeks that I played with Ronaldo, I could already feel that Ronaldo’s figure was very crucial for the team,”

“He understands how this team plays,”

“Marcelo was right when he said that I would learn a lot from Ronaldo.”

Ronaldo successfully became an example for anyone who saw his game. The Juventus coach considers that Ronaldo is a very extraordinary figure for young players. For the 51-year-old coach, whoever who wants to be the best player, they simply do what Ronaldo does.

Ronaldo successfully became the greatest soccer player in the world. So it is wrong if we are rushing to throw criticism and insults on him. He is a hard worker and always has a way to get out of the difficulties he is facing.
